Cura’s BeWell Kitchens are increasing to extra senior residing communities, because of cooks who make wholesome consuming enjoyable, instructional and attractive for residents.

The culinary group at Presbyterian Senior Dwelling at Westminster Woods in Huntindon, Pa. created the primary educating kitchen, primarily based on a mannequin developed by the Culinary Institute of America and the Harvard T.H. Chan College of Public Well being. Cura cooks and dietitians developed the idea into the corporate’s BeWell Kitchens, which at the moment are additionally in place at Presbyterian Manors of Mid America at Wichita and Parsons Presbyterian Manors, each positioned in Kansas, in addition to operations in Texas, Louisiana and Florida.

By way of chef demos and hands-on interactive experiences, residents learn to put together a BeWell recipe with out it seeming like college. Individuals then take house laminated recipes to allow them to put together the dishes in their very own kitchens. The culinary demonstrations additionally incorporate a small dose of vitamin schooling—however the employees is cautious to not overdo it.  

Cura Company Government Chef Lance Franklin is a residing function mannequin at how wholesome makeovers of favourite recipes could make an enormous distinction—and he spreads the message.

13 years in the past, Franklin drastically modified his consuming habits and mindset to get again to a wholesome weight.

“I’m a pescatarian and attempt to eat as clear as I can,” he says. “I train my cooks and cooks the best way to scale back meat on the plate and make substitutions. As a chef, you’ll be able to enhance your consuming habits by experimenting. You by no means run out of choices.”

One in all his favorites is a more healthy model of lasagna that substitutes mushrooms for meat. That’s one of many recipes demonstrated within the BeWell Kitchens, together with turkey burgers rather than beef burgers. Franklin and Cura’s company director of culinary operations Chris Greve have additionally developed anti-inflammatory and brain-boosting spice blends to season dishes. These components assist join contributors to the idea of practical meals that transcend vitamin to assist well being and stop illness.

Together with the cooks and cooks, registered dietitians additionally participate within the demos to speak the vitamin message. “I work with the neighborhood’s life enrichment director to coordinate a time for the occasion between lunch and dinner and provides residents sufficient time to rsvp,” stated Torehn Windt, regional dietitian and menu supervisor for the 2 Kansas operations.

At a latest demo, Windt and David Wills, director of culinary for Presbyterian Manors of Mid America, ready a summer season rooster salad. The ingredient set-up included zucchini, summer season squash, peppers, pine nuts, tomatoes, cucumbers, beans, cooked rooster and peach French dressing dressing.

“The recipe gave residents the chance to toss their very own salad with us,” stated Windt. “For these residents who didn’t take part, we had tasters so they might pattern and observe.”

Resident Donna Berner was completely engaged. “I realized many new issues and am desperate to grill zucchini and put together that scrumptious peach French dressing dressing,” she stated. “I instantly added frozen peaches to my buying record.”
